Transaction 53b90ba3a056fbe94eb8e3d5f93dad39fb646fcabbb6476d802f6b9cbb8775ab

1 Input
2 Outputs
  • 53b90ba3a056fbe94eb8e3d5f93dad39fb646fcabbb6476d802f6b9cbb8775ab:0
  • value  1398090410
    address  17ca9U2JbTYoYF9RyTU2t5cwYaahnkz2H7
  • 53b90ba3a056fbe94eb8e3d5f93dad39fb646fcabbb6476d802f6b9cbb8775ab:1
  • value  99847695
    address  15sQbrSsKGSWqLjEnoSfbXMxTmbvFMn6LU